Yarn Store On Samui

Featured Replies

Hi!

Does anybody know where on Samui yarn can be bought? Please name the stores and approximate address, if it is possible!

Thanks in advance :)

There is a store in Nanton, sorry don't know the name, but, if you go past Tesco.... and watch out for the Vegetable Market on same side. a few blocks up.

There is a side street at the market ...turn left there & go up about 50 feet or so & there is a Fabric store, on the left.

I am pretty certain I seen yarn in there & general sowing supplies too. Good selection of fabrics too.

There's a haberdashery on the Lake Rd going towards Chaweng. Sorry don't know the name but it's opposite that Jewellry place where the guys sit in the window making the jewellry. Not far after the Tourism College. They have fabrics, knitting yarns, needles, etc.

ordinary black/white thread/yarn is found in Family marts too!

Standing with your back to the gas station in Lamai, look right across the road just past the 7-Eleven...maybe four shops down is an arts and crafts place that has a surprising amount of stuff for all manner of these hobbies. I don't think there is a sign, but it looks like a mom and pop shop.
